One of Nation's Largest Stages Coming to Clyde

The shores of Lake Clyde will soon be home to the largest permanent outdoor stage in Texas.

"This will be the place to be in West Texas," said Mayor Hawk.

The complex will not only play host to large outdoor concerts but smaller corporate retreats and banquets as well.

"It's a one-of-a-kind even outside the state," says Mark Powell of Backporch Productions.

The 75,000 square foot stage and surrounding grounds have a maximum capacity of 40,000 people.

"It would be one of the biggest structures for an outdoor concert there is," said Powell.

With a stage of that magnitude, the Big Country could recruit top acts from the country music billboards

"You're talking about the top ten current guys that we're trying to attract," said Powell.

In addition to spotlighting big-name musical talents, the complex would be an opportunity for Clyde to showcase their community.

"People are taking notice of Clyde, and I think this is another example of what we're doing to make it a great place to live," said Mayor Dustin Hawk.

But with construction and renovations costing upwards of $2 million, Backporch Productions says everyone in the Big Country will play a part.

When completed the Backporch of Texas stage will certainly be one Clyde and the Big Country can all be proud of.

"People are already proud of Clyde America, but this will really help with showing other people," said Mayor Hawk.

Construction on the massive complex is expected to be completed by mid-January, the first concert to be held will be the Wild West Fest in late October.
